What is the Goethe Certificate A1?
The Goethe Certificate A1 is a main qualification awarded by the Goethe-Institut, a worldwide recognized organization committed to promoting the German language and culture. It represents level A1 of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), which classifies language efficiency throughout 6 levels from A1 (newbie) to C2 (competent).

What Does the A1 Exam Entail?
The Goethe Certificate A1 assessment includes 4 sections, each designed to examine different elements of language proficiency:

Listening Comprehension: This area tests the ability to understand spoken German in different contexts, such as conversation or directions, usually utilizing audio clips.

Reading Comprehension: Here, examinees read short texts, such as ads or easy short articles, and respond to related concerns to show understanding.

Composing: Candidates are entrusted with composing brief texts, like submitting types or crafting basic messages, showcasing their ability to communicate in writing.

Speaking: This practical section includes a conversation with a test manager or other examinee, where candidates react to questions and take part in standard discussion.

Structure of the Exam
The A1 examination is usually structured as follows:

Duration: The entire exam lasts about 70 minutes, divided among the four sections.
Score: Each section is scored separately, and candidates usually need a minimum score to pass.
Grading: Results are provided on a scale that shows the level of efficiency obtained.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s).
Q1: How long does it generally take to reach A1-level proficiency?
A1-level efficiency is usually achievable in about 80 to 150 hours of concentrated research study, depending on the individual's language-learning abilities and previous exposure to German.

Q2: Is the Goethe Certificate A1 recognized globally?
Yes, the Goethe Certificate A1 is acknowledged by a variety of organizations and organizations around the world as an official certification of German language proficiency.

Q3: How can I sign up for the exam?
Registration for the Goethe Certificate A1 can be done through regional Goethe-Institut branches or through their official site. It is recommended to examine particular eligibility requirements and schedules.

Q4: What resources can I utilize to prepare for the exam?
Advised resources consist of books focused on A1 students, language apps like Duolingo or Babbel, and online platforms that provide practice tests and workouts tailored for A1.

Q5: Can I take the exam online?
As of now, most Goethe Certificate A1 tests are conducted face to face, however it's suggested to check the Goethe-Institut's official interactions for any updates relating to remote testing alternatives.
